Microsoft, the world’s largest software company, has announced its profits for the April to June period and has exceeded analysts expectations.
The company said profits hit $4.52 billion (£2.96 billion) for the second quarter – a rise of 48% compared with the same period a year earlier.

Online search giant Yahoo has published its second quarter results which disappointed the market, sending its shares diving more than 7%.
Profits at the company grew by more than 50% in the quarter, but net revenues missed expectations.

US search engine giant, Google, said revenues surged 23% in the first quarter of 2010 to $6.77 billion, compared with $5.51 billion in the same period a year ago – the greatest revenue growth since the third quarter of 2008.

The 10-year search and advertising deal between Microsoft and Yahoo has been approved today by both the US Department of Justice and the European Commission.
Both companies said they plan to begin the tie-up in the next few days and the deal will be finalised by early 2012.

Online search giant Yahoo has posted strong quarter four profits but said sales continue to decline.
The company said net profit in the October to December period was $153 million (£95 million) compared with a $303 million loss in the same period in 2008.
